Origin and History:

Satta Matka and traditional lotteries have distinct historical backgrounds. Satta Matka originated in India, particularly in Mumbai, throughout the 1960s. It was initially a betting game based on the opening and shutting rates of cotton transmitted from the New York Cotton Exchange. Over time, it evolved right into a more complex form of playing involving the choice of numbers and betting on various outcomes. Satta Matka has deep-rooted connections with the Indian tradition and has been a part of many individuals’s lives for decades.

However, traditional lotteries have a longer history that dates back to ancient civilizations. The idea of lotteries will be traced to China, the place the primary recorded lottery was held through the Han Dynasty around 205-187 BCE. Lotteries have been used as a means to boost funds for numerous public projects, such because the Great Wall of China and the construction of essential infrastructure. Traditional lotteries have since spread across the world, and lots of nations have their own variations of the game.

Gameplay:

Satta Matka and traditional lotteries differ significantly in their gameplay. In Satta Matka, players select a set of numbers from a predefined range, usually based on historical results or lucky numbers. These numbers are then guess on, and the results are declared at specific occasions during the day. The game is known for its complicated set of rules, strategies, and betting options, making it a difficult but enticing selection for gamblers.

In contrast, traditional lotteries involve purchasing tickets with pre-printed numbers or combinations. Players have little control over the numbers they obtain, and the outcomes are solely based on chance. Lotteries typically have a fixed draw date, and the winning numbers are drawn randomly, often in a public setting to ensure transparency. The simplicity of traditional lotteries makes them accessible to a wide range of individuals, regardless of their familiarity with gambling.

Legality and Regulation:

The legal status and regulation of Satta Matka and traditional lotteries additionally differ significantly. Traditional lotteries are sometimes regulated and operated by government creatorities. These lotteries are seen as a legitimate technique of elevating funds for public welfare and are topic to strict oversight to forestall fraud and ensure fairness. Governments use revenue generated from lotteries to help various projects, equivalent to schooling, healthcare, and infrastructure development.

However, Satta Matka operates in a legal grey area. While it is illegal in many parts of India attributable to its association with illegal betting and arranged crime, it continues to thrive in underground markets. The lack of regulation in Satta Matka makes it a riskier and less reliable form of playing, with players usually vulnerable to scams and fraud.
